Semiconductor manufacturing giant TSMC pushes development of second chip plant in Japan with new investor Toyota

Semiconductor manufacturing giant TSMC pushes development of second chip plant in Japan with new investor Toyota

TSMC, the world’s largest contract chip maker, said that Toyota Motor Corp will be joining as a new investor of Japan Advanced Semiconductor Manufacturing (JASM), the Taiwanese firm’s majority-owned manufacturing subsidiary in Kumamoto Prefecture on the southwestern island of Kyushu.
